Engadget Index up $19.20 on first day 'trading'


Wall Street has the DJIA, Silicon Valley, the NASDAQ. Now gadget-happy geeks everywhere (yes, we resemble that remark) have their own benchmark: The Engadget Index. Announced today, our friends over at Engadget have assembled an assortment of their 50 favorite gadget stocks.



And today, on its first day of "trading," the Engadget Index was up $19.20 to $1552.94. Marked by especially good results from Sony Corporation (ADR) (NYSE:SNE) (up $1.54, or 3.78$, to $42.30) and Sprint Nextel Corporation (NYSE:S) (up $1.18, a whopping 6.66%, to $18.90), Logitech International SA (ADR) (NASDAQ:LOGI) (up $1.15, 4.58%, to $26.27), and Garmin Ltd. (NASDAQ:GRMN) (up $1.96, 3.70%, to $54.87).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NYSE:AMD), up 3.22% to $21.50, is also worth mentioning.

Only one stock in the new index was down any noticeable amount: NEC Corporation (ADR) (NASDAQ:NIPNY), down 19 cents or 3.54% to $5.24.
